Enhanced Accuracy and Efficiency

Point of care software brings a new level of accuracy and efficiency to healthcare facilities. By integrating seamlessly with existing systems, it eliminates the need for manual data entry, reducing the risk of errors and saving valuable time. With automated workflows and real-time updates, healthcare professionals can access updated patient information, lab results, and treatment plans instantaneously. This level of efficiency empowers healthcare providers to make well-informed decisions promptly, enhancing patient care and outcomes.

Streamlining Documentation and Records

The transition from paper-based records to digital documentation has been a significant leap forward in the healthcare industry. Point of care software takes this a step further, providing a centralized platform to consolidate patient records, treatment plans, and medical histories. This comprehensive view helps healthcare professionals gain a holistic understanding of each patient's needs, improving collaboration and communication between providers. Doctors, nurses, and administrative staff can easily access and update patient information, reducing paperwork and potential errors.

Improved Patient Engagement and Satisfaction

With point of care software, patients become active participants in their healthcare journey. Access to online portals empowers patients to view their medical records and test results, understand treatment plans, and communicate directly with healthcare providers. This increased engagement fosters a sense of involvement and trust, leading to higher patient satisfaction levels. The software also enables prompt appointment scheduling, prescription refills, and virtual consultations, enhancing convenience and overall patient experience.

Efficient Care Coordination and Collaboration

Healthcare is a team effort, requiring seamless coordination and collaboration across various departments and specialties. Traditional practices often face challenges with communication between healthcare providers. Point of care software addresses this issue by providing secure messaging platforms, shared calendars, and task management features. By streamlining communication channels, healthcare professionals can easily consult one another, reducing delays and errors in patient care. These software solutions also facilitate interdisciplinary collaboration, ensuring that all providers have access to the same updated patient information, leading to more informed decision-making.

Integration with Medical Devices and Internet of Things (IoT)

As technology continues to advance, the integration of medical devices and IoT with point of care software offers new possibilities in healthcare. By connecting devices like wearables, remote monitoring tools, and diagnostic equipment, healthcare providers can collect real-time data, improving patient management and preventive care. For example, a patient's vital signs can be monitored remotely, and any abnormalities can trigger immediate alerts to caregivers. The integration of these technologies with point of care software creates a more comprehensive and proactive approach to healthcare delivery.

Data Analytics and Insights

One of the key advantages of point of care software is the ability to collect and analyze large amounts of data. These software solutions offer powerful data analytics tools that can help identify trends, patterns, and areas for improvement. By leveraging this valuable information, healthcare organizations can make data-driven decisions, optimize workflows, and enhance patient outcomes. Additionally, data analytics enable population health management, allowing healthcare providers to identify high-risk patients and implement targeted interventions for better care delivery.

Security and Compliance

In an era where data breaches and privacy concerns are prevalent, point of care software prioritizes security and compliance. These software solutions adhere to strict data protection policies, ensuring the confidentiality and integrity of patient information. Advanced encryption techniques, role-based access controls, and regular security audits are implemented to safeguard sensitive data. Compliance with industry regulations, such as HIPAA, further reinforces the commitment to maintaining patient privacy and confidentiality.
